TIPS FOR ASSEMBLY

CONSEJOS PARA EL MONTAGE

  1. USE QUALITY HEX DRIVERS TO AVOID STRIPPING SCREW HEADS.
  2. USE THREAD LOCK WHEN PUTTING METAL SCREWS INTO METAL PARTS.
  3. NOTE: STEPS MARKED WITH AN ASTERISK (*) REQUIRE THREAD LOCK.
  4. USE THREAD LOCK SPARINGLY.
  5. DO NOT OVER TIGHTEN SCREWS OTHERWISE YOU MAY STRIP THE THREAD.

Safety Information

Failure to operate your model in a safe and responsible manner may result in property damage and serious injury. The precautions outlined in this manual should be strictly followed to help ensure safe operation. You alone must see that the instructions are followed and the precautions are adhered to.
Important Points to Remember

  • Your model is not intended for use on public roads or congested areas where its operation can conflict with or disrupt pedestrian or vehicular traffic.
  • Never, under any circumstances, operate the model in crowds of people. Your model could cause injury if allowed to collide with anyone.
  • Because your model is controlled by radio, it is subject to radio interference from many sources that are beyond your control. Since radio interference can cause momentary loss of radio control, always allow a safety margin in all directions around the model in order to prevent collisions.
  • The motor, battery, and speed control can become hot during use. Be careful to avoid getting burned.
  • Don’t operate your model at night, or anytime your line of sight to the model may be obstructed or impaired in any way.
  • Most importantly, use good common sense at all times.

Speed Control

  • Your model’s electronic speed control (ESC) is an extremely powerful electronic device capable of delivering high current. Please closely follow these precautions to prevent damage to the speed control or other components.
  • Disconnect the Battery: Always disconnect the battery from the speed control when not in use.
  • Insulate the Wires: Always insulate exposed wiring with heat shrink tubing to prevent short circuits.
  • 6-7 NiMH cells or 2-3 LiPo cells (2s/3s): The ESC can accept a maximum input voltage of 8.4 volts (NiMH) or 11.1 volts (3s LiPo). Always adhere to the minimum and maximum limitations of the ESC as stated in the specifications table.
  • Transmitter on First: Switch on your transmitter first before switching on the speed control to prevent runaways and erratic performance.
  • Don’t Get Burned: The ESC and motor can become extremely hot during use, so be careful not to touch them until they cool. Supply adequate airflow for cooling.
  • Use the Factory-Installed Connectors: Do not change the battery and motor connectors. Improper wiring can cause fire or damage to the ESC.
  • No Reverse Voltage: The ESC is not protected against reverse polarity voltage.

Important Warnings for users of Lithium Polymer (LIPo) batteries:

  • LiPo batteries have a minimum safe discharge voltage threshold that should not be exceeded. The electronic speed control is equipped with built-in Low-Voltage Detection that stops the vehicle when LiPo batteries have reached their minimum voltage (discharge) threshold. It is the driver’s responsibility to stop immediately to prevent the battery pack from being discharged below its safe minimum threshold.
  • Low-Voltage Detection is just one part of a comprehensive plan for safe LiPo battery use. It is critical to follow all instructions for safe and proper charging, use, and storage of LiPo batteries. Make sure you understand how to use your LiPo batteries. If you have questions about LiPo battery usage, please consult with your local hobby dealer or contact the battery manufacturer. As a reminder, all batteries should be recycled at the end of their useful life.
  • ONLY use a Lithium Polymer (LiPo) balance charger with a balance adapter port to charge LiPo batteries. Never use NiMH or NiCad type chargers or charge modes to charge LiPo batteries. DO NOT charge with a NiMH-only charger. The use of a NiMH or NiCad charger or charge mode will damage the batteries and may cause fire and personal injury.
  • NEVER charge LiPo battery packs in series or parallel. Charging packs in series or parallel may result in improper charger cell recognition and an improper charging rate that may lead to overcharging, cell imbalance, cell damage, and fire.
  • ALWAYS inspect your LiPo batteries carefully before charging. Look for any loose leads or connectors, damaged wire insulation, damaged cell packaging, impact damage, fluid leaks, swelling (a sign of internal damage), cell deformity, missing labels, or any other damage or irregularity. If any of these conditions are observed, do not charge or use the battery pack. Follow the disposal instructions included with your battery to properly and safely dispose of the battery.
  • DO NOT store or charge LiPo batteries with or around other batteries or battery packs of any type, including other LiPos.
  • Store and transport your battery pack(s) in a cool dry place. DO NOT store in direct sunlight. DO NOT allow the storage temperature to exceed 140°F or 60°C, such as in the trunk of a car, or the cells may be damaged and create a fire risk.
  • DO NOT disassemble LiPo batteries or cells.
  • DO NOT attempt to build your own LiPo battery pack from loose cells.

Charging and handNng precautions for all battery types:

  • BEFORE you charge, ALWAYS confirm that the charger settings exactly match the type (chemistry), specification, and configuration of the battery to be charged.
  • DO NOT attempt to charge non-rechargeable batteries (explosion hazard), batteries that have an internal charge circuit or a protection circuit, batteries that have been altered from original manufacturer configuration, or batteries that have missing or unreadable labels, preventing you from properly identifying the battery type and Specifications.
  • DO NOT exceed the maximum manufacturer recommended charge Rate.
  • DO NOT let any exposed battery contacts or wires touch each other. This will cause the battery to short circuit and create the risk of fire.
  • While charging or discharging, ALWAYS place the battery (all types of batteries) in a fire retardant/fire proof container and on a non-flammable surface such as concrete.
  • DO NOT charge batteries inside of an automobile. DO NOT charge batteries while driving in an automobile.
  • NEVER charge batteries on wood, cloth, carpet, or on any other flammable material.
  • ALWAYS charge batteries in a well-ventilated area.
  • REMOVE flammable items and combustible materials from the charging area.
  • DO NOT leave the charger and battery unattended while charging, discharging, or anytime the charger is ON with a battery connected. If there are any signs of a malfunction or in the event of an emergency, unplug the charger from the power source and disconnect the battery from the charger.
  • DO NOT operate the charger in a cluttered space, or place objects on top of the charger or battery.
  • If any battery or battery cell is damaged in any way, DO NOT charge, discharge, or use the battery.
  • Keep a Class D fire extinguisher nearby in case of fire.
  • DO NOT disassemble, crush, short circuit, or expose the batteries to flame or other source of ignition. Toxic materials could be released. If eye or skin contact occurs, flush with water.
  • If a battery gets hot to the touch during the charging process (temperature greater than 110°F / 43°C), immediately disconnect the battery from the charger and discontinue charging.
  • Allow the battery pack to cool off between runs (before charging).
  • ALWAYS unplug the charger and disconnect the battery when not in use.
  • ALWAYS unplug the battery from the electronic speed control when the model is not in use and when it is being stored or transported.
  • DO NOT disassemble the charger.
  • REMOVE the battery from your model or device before charging.
  • DO NOT expose the charger to water or moisture.
  • ALWAYS store battery packs safely out of the reach of children or pets. Children should always have adult supervision when charging and handling batteries.
  • Nickel-Metal Hydride (NiMH) batteries must be recycled or disposed of properly.
  • Always proceed with caution and use good common sense at all times.

How to Set Parameters

  1. Outcry III ESC uses jumper caps to set running mode & battery type.
    We suggest users using tweezers or needle-nose pliers to set parameters by plugging / unplugging the jumper cap (as shown in the picture above);
    For example, if you want set the battery type to the “LiPo” mode, you only need to plug the jumper cap into left two pins of the battery pin header.

Programmable ltems

  1. Running Mode: 3 Options (Fwd / Br / Rev, Fwd / Br, Fwd / Rev). The “Fwd / Br / Rev” is the default option. Fwd=For- ward, Br=Brake, Rev=Reverse
    “Fwd / Br / Rev” mode indicates the vehicle can go forward, backward and brake. This mode uses “Double-click” method to make the vehicle reverse. When moving the throttle Trigger/Stick from the neutral Reverse Position for the 1st time, the ESC begins to brake the motor and the motor slows down but is still running, so the reverse is NOT performed immediately. When the throttle Trigger/Stick is moved to the Reverse Position again, if the motor speed slows down to zero (i.e. stopped), the vehicle will move in reverse. This “Double- click” method prevents reversing immediately when the brake function is frequently used in steering. Therefore, this mode is often used in daily practice.
    “Fwd / Br” mode, the vehicle can go forward and brake, but no reversing, so this mode is often used in competitions.
    “Fwd / Rev” mode uses “Single-click” method to make the vehicle reverse. When moving the throttle Trigger/Stick from neutral zone to backward zone, the vehicle reverses immediately, so this mode is usually used for rock crawlers.

  2. Battery Type: 2 Options (Lipo, NiMH), the “Lipo” is the default option.

Protection Features

  1. Low Voltage Cutoff Protection (LVC): If the voltage of battery pack is lower than the threshold for 2 seconds, the ESC will enter protection mode, so the motor speed will be lowered (when voltage is lower than the 1st trigger point) till stopped (when voltage is lower than the 2nd trigger point). When the car stops, the red LED blinks to indicate the low voltage cut-off protection has been activated.
    • 2S Lipo: When the voltage is below 6.5V, the output power will be halved. When the voltage is lower than 6.0V, the output will be cut off and won’t be resumed again.
    • 3s Lipo: When the voltage is below 9.75V, the output power will be halved. When the voltage is lower than 9.0V, the output will be cut off and won’t be resumed again
    • 5-9S Lipo: When the voltage is below 4.5V, the output power will be halved. When the voltage is lower than 4.0V, the output will be cut off and won’t be resumed again.

  2. Over-heat Protection: When the internal temperature of the ESC is higher than 100 degrees Celsius, or 211 degrees Fahrenheit, this protection will be activated and the output power will be reduced until cut off. The RED LED blinks when the vehicle stops, and the ESC will not resume output power until its temperature is below 80 Celsius degrees or 176 degrees Fahrenheit.

  3. Throttle signal loss protection: The ESC will cut off the output power if the throttle signal has been lost for 0.1 second.
    The “Fail-Safe” function of the radio system is strongly recommended to be activated.
